S.531: A bill to authorize the President to award a gold medal on behalf of the Congress to Rosa Parks in recognition of her contributions to the Nation.
About This Bill
- This bill was introduced in the 106th Congress
- This bill is primarily about congress
- Introduced March 4, 1999
- Latest Major Action May 4, 1999
